Intermittent fasting (IF), an eating pattern that cycles between periods of eating and voluntary caloric restriction, has become a popular strategy for metabolic health. A rest day is a non-negotiable component of any serious fitness regimen, allowing the body to adapt and rebuild from the stress of exercise. The question of whether to combine these two practices—fasting on a dedicated rest day—involves navigating complex physiological trade-offs. Determining the optimal strategy requires understanding how the body recovers and how a lack of calories influences the repair process.
The Role of Rest Days in Recovery
A rest day is a period of intense biological activity focused on adaptation and repair, not simply a day off from the gym. The physical stress of exercise, particularly resistance training, creates microscopic damage in muscle fibers. This signals the body to begin muscle protein synthesis (MPS), which rebuilds and strengthens the muscle, with synthesis rates peaking approximately 24 to 48 hours after a workout. Rest days also allow the body to restore muscle glycogen, the primary energy source for high-intensity activity. Adequate rest and nutrient availability are necessary to ensure these recovery processes are completed effectively.
How Fasting Affects Recovery Metabolism
Fasting introduces a distinct metabolic environment that interacts directly with the body’s recovery needs. When food intake is restricted, the body shifts away from utilizing glucose for fuel and begins breaking down stored body fat. This metabolic shift enhances fat oxidation and improves insulin sensitivity, benefiting overall metabolic health. Fasting also triggers autophagy, a cellular cleanup process that removes damaged cells and recycles components. However, the absence of dietary amino acids during a fast can impede the MPS pathway, which requires a steady supply of protein building blocks for muscle repair and growth.
Aligning Fasting with Fitness Goals
The decision to fast on a rest day should align with an individual’s specific fitness objectives. For those prioritizing fat loss, fasting on a rest day is an effective tool. It helps create a significant caloric deficit and enhances the body’s ability to burn stored fat, especially since the low-activity rest day requires fewer calories than a training day. Conversely, individuals focused intensely on maximizing muscle hypertrophy may find fasting counterproductive. Muscle growth depends on a positive net protein balance, which is best achieved by consistently supplying the body with protein to stimulate MPS throughout the day.
Important Safety Considerations
Attempting to fast on a rest day requires careful attention to hydration and nutrient intake during the designated eating window. The body continues to lose water and electrolytes, so consistently consuming plain water, black coffee, or unsweetened teas is necessary to prevent dehydration. Maintaining electrolyte balance, particularly sodium and potassium, is important to avoid lightheadedness or muscle cramps during the fasting period. Fasting is not appropriate for everyone, and certain medical conditions strongly advise against it. Individuals with a history of disordered eating, Type 1 or Type 2 diabetes who rely on insulin, or those who are pregnant or breastfeeding should avoid intermittent fasting. Consulting with a healthcare professional before incorporating any new fasting regimen is a necessary precaution.
